Ordinals
beta
Address 3Em5feiZsE2VvRQryNG4X7ERzA5fhu9XzD
sat balance
1852600
runes balances
outputs
eaeb4c57e984918f1da20be5509d4ef6d92311f2b107d18ada40e6c6c2f44cee:1